Hi!
I've taken 2 OPKS since stopping the pill 6 weeks ago - the darker one is this morning, lighter one from last night. How many times a day should I be testing? Is it a good sign that it's darkening and when may I expect a peak? 😅

You will always get a line with these. Both of those are negative results and it doesn't matter that one is slightly darker. I used the easy@home strips and the free version of the premom app and conceived on three of the four cycles I tested for. Have you had a normal period since stopping the pill (not a withdrawal bleed)? If so I'd test twice a day (morning and night) for your first cycle so you can see when you typically ovulate, and if you don't get pregnant on that cycle I'd test once a day until five days out and then twice a day until your peak.
